COLLISION OF TWO PBY-5
CATALINAS
PERTH AREA, WA
ON 1 MARCH 1944
![]()
The War Diary for Patrol Squadron One Hundred and One had the following entry:-
WAR DIARY
For March 1944.
| Mar. 1 | Three (3)
planes Ferry flight, Perth to Adelaide. Nine (9) planes local training flights (Midair collision between PBY-5 Bureau number 08134 of VP-101 and PBY-5 Bureau number 08297 of VP-11 resulted in slight injury to pilot of PBY-5 Bureau number 08134. Damage to both planes repairable. |
PBY-5 Catalina Bu. No. 08134 sank in another incident in the Perth area on 7 March 1944.
